WebJul 12, 2024 · UCS is used for determining the suitability of the mix to perform satisfactorily as a bound sub-base and base layer (Paige 1998; Vorobeiff 2004; ... The default value of MOR of soil cement and cement treated aggregate are taken as 0.69 MPa corresponding to minimum 28 days UCS value of 5.17 MPa (ARA 2004). Cement-treated base also is referred to as lean concrete and cement bound granular materials. It generally is mixed in a batch plant according to the strength, durability, and uniformity requirements for the layer being constructed.
